Horizon launches 45m Horizon Polaris

Horizon has launched the new 45m (148ft) EP148 Horizon Polaris, which is the largest flagship built by Horizon as well as the largest BV Ice Classification private yacht to be built in Asia.

Horizon Polaris has a steel hull, aluminum superstructure and bulbous bow, and her design is the result of collaboration between interior design consultant Birgit Schannese of Germany, US designer J.C. Espinosa, and the Horizon R&D team.

With a 9m (29ft) beam, she features a and spacious layout with five en-suite staterooms, including an on-deck master with an office and a large crew area with room for 10 crew.

Additional features include a transom garage, water toy storage on the bow, gym and spa in the Skylounge, and an entertainment area on the flybridge with a Jacuzzi, numerous sunpads and a full bar.

Powered with twin MTU 12V 4000 M60 1760HP engines, the new EP148 reaches a top speed of 16kt and has a range of over 4,200nm at 9.5kt.

The owners are preparing for a cruise through the rough seas around Taiwan in early June, and she will debut at the Horizon Yachts Open House on 28 June in Taiwan.
